Versatile and Unconventional Construction:
All-Clad makes all of their stainless steel cookware in a similar way. This method of manufacturing is called diffusion bonding also known as roll bonding. This manufacturing process provides alternating layers of different metals that have been mixed together to create alloys. This current process of manufacturing is a practice that has been continued since they were first founded back in 1971. They regularly update their patent on these solid-state bonding techniques that have been used in the multi-layered cookware that helps them improve the quality and usability of their products as well as increase customer satisfaction.
They use a high temperature and pressure to adhere to the metals in a pattern that is extremely hard to replicate. Both the cookware sets are remarkable at heating across the whole surface area of the base and the walls because of the construction. They have also controlled the heat conductance on the sidewalls in their frying pans with this method to exile the accidental oil splatter that might cause harm to you.
Over Safe and Induction Compatible Build
When it comes to their compatibility with your oven and induction, you generally want to see both of them working fine with your cookware. You will be satisfied to know that both the Copper Core and D5 cookware sets are indeed oven and boiler safe and can handle up to 600 degrees Fahrenheit. This is extremely sufficient to cook steaks and other meats that need high heat to get to the right place. They are able to handle this temperature and are compatible with induction cooktops because of the SAE 400 series stainless steel grade exterior.
Care For The Cookware:
Cleaning your cookware can be a hassle especially if you do not have the extra time to wash them and get the grease off. That is why, both the Copper Core and D5 stainless steel cookware sets are made from dishwasher safe material. Although, All-Clad does suggest you go ahead and hand wash the cookware with a little bit of dish soap and warm water. They do not suggest you use a dishwasher as the detergent may damage the exterior of the stainless steel or completely ruin the other copper ring which will destroy the aesthetic of the cookware.

Core Layer of the Cookware:
Although both the brands incorporate a 5 layer metal bonding within their sets using their production methods, they use different central layers. The core layer used in the D5 set is made out of stainless steel that has low heat conductance compared to that of the Copper Core central layer which is copper; a known efficient heat conductor.
All Of The Layers:
Speaking of all the central layers found within the All-Clad Copper Core vs D5 cookware sets, here is a chart of all 5 layers found in both D5 and Copper Core cookware sets:

All-Clad Copper Core vs D5 Cookware Internal Layers:
Layers | All-Clad D5 | All-Clad Copper Core |
---|---|---|
Layer 1 | Ferromagnetic stainless steel. | Ferromagnetic stainless steel. |
Layer 2 | Aluminum. | Aluminum. |
Layer 3 | Stainless Steel | Copper. |
Layer 4 | Aluminum. | Aluminum. |
Layer 5 | 18/10 stainless steel. | 18/10 stainless steel. |

Cooking Performance:
This is by far the biggest difference found within D5 and Copper Core cookware collections. What you need to know about the cooking performance of the D5 set is that because it is made from a stainless steel core layer, it does not conduct heat as fast and efficiently. This can be utilized and used to your advantage as you will have more control over the heat response to your food. This means if you turn up the heat, the cookware will have a gradual ramp-up compared to an extremely high temperature from the beginning.

On the other hand, if you want a collection that provides the user with a quick and hasty heat response, Copper-Core is better in this regard because of its copper internal layer. This option is generally used by professional and skilled chefs who want a rapid change in temperature. The drawback to this is that if the heat is left high for only a few seconds and you realize it is too hot, it will probably be too late. This option is recommended for you only if you are a skilled home cook and not a newbie.

Design and Appearance:
While both the D5 and Copper Core collections are aesthetic in their own unique way, they do have some features in terms of their appearance that are worth noticing. Although it might not help you in your cooking, a stylish cookware set can really make your kitchen look decorative. When it comes to the outer look of the D5 sets, they come in both polished and brushed stainless steel finishes. The polished has a much shinier surface but the brushed one makes the pots look classy.
Meanwhile, the Copper Core kitchen set is only available with an elegant polished finish. A feature added to enhance the appearance of this cookware set, All-Clad has gone ahead and added a graceful copper ring around the outer bottom of the cookware. This not only looks awesome but also helps heat up the cookware faster. This copper ring also makes the Copper Core kitchen set easily distinguishable in a crowd of cookware sets.
Besides the outer appearance, The D5 and Copper Core kitchen sets differ in their lid’s handle designs. When it comes to the All-Clad D5 set, the cookware lids have more of a square handle compared to that of the Copper core, which comes in a much more rounded shape.
